Tirana vs Cape Parry, Nt Climate & Distance Between

Canada flag
  • The distance between Tirana, Albania and Cape Parry, Nt, Canada is approximately 7,289 km or 4,530 mi.
  • To reach Tirana in this distance one would set out from Cape Parry, Nt bearing 28.6° or NNE and follow the great circles arc to approach Tirana bearing 167.5° or SSE .
  • Tirana has a Mediterranean hot climate (Csa) whereas Cape Parry, Nt has a tundra climate (ET).
  • The average annual temperature is 27.2 °C (49°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 17.2 °C (31°F) less in Tirana. The continentality subtype is semicontinental as opposed to truly continental.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 1028.6 mm (40.5 in) more which is equivalent to 1028.6 l/m² (25.24 US gal/ft²) or 10,286,000 l/ha (1,099,642 US gal/ac) more. About 7 2/5 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 28.8° higher in Tirana than in Cape Parry, Nt.
